mirror of
https://gitlab.com/freepascal.org/fpc/source.git
synced 2025-08-18 08:29:20 +02:00
* Fix compilation after Lacos changes to TFieldType
git-svn-id: trunk@47223 -
(cherry picked from commit 7f6d0fec96
)
This commit is contained in:
parent
746f1ffcc8
commit
be620090ad
@ -58,10 +58,14 @@ const
|
|||||||
//ftOraTimeStamp, ftOraInterval
|
//ftOraTimeStamp, ftOraInterval
|
||||||
{$IFEND }
|
{$IFEND }
|
||||||
{$IF Declared(ftLongWord)}
|
{$IF Declared(ftLongWord)}
|
||||||
, StringType, StringType, StringType, StringType, StringType, StringType, StringType,
|
, StringType, StringType, StringType, StringType
|
||||||
//ftLongWord, ftShortint, ftByte, ftExtended, ftConnection, ftParams, ftStream,
|
//ftLongWord, ftShortint, ftByte, ftExtended,
|
||||||
|
{$IFNDEF FPC}
|
||||||
|
, StringType, StringType, StringType,
|
||||||
|
// ftConnection, ftParams, ftStream,
|
||||||
StringType, StringType, StringType
|
StringType, StringType, StringType
|
||||||
//ftTimeStampOffset, ftObject, ftSingle
|
//ftTimeStampOffset, ftObject, ftSingle
|
||||||
|
{$ENDIF}
|
||||||
{$IFEND }
|
{$IFEND }
|
||||||
);
|
);
|
||||||
|
|
||||||
|
@ -1220,13 +1220,14 @@ class function TSQLDBRestResource.FieldTypeToRestFieldType(
|
|||||||
|
|
||||||
Const
|
Const
|
||||||
Map : Array[TFieldType] of TRestFieldType =
|
Map : Array[TFieldType] of TRestFieldType =
|
||||||
(rftUnknown, rftString, rftInteger, rftInteger, rftInteger, // ftUnknown, ftString, ftSmallint, ftInteger, ftWord,
|
(rftUnknown, rftString, rftInteger, rftInteger, rftInteger, // ftUnknown, ftString, ftSmallint, ftInteger, ftWord,
|
||||||
rftBoolean, rftFloat, rftFloat, rftFloat, rftDate, rftTime, rftDateTime, // ftBoolean, ftFloat, ftCurrency, ftBCD, ftDate, ftTime, ftDateTime,
|
rftBoolean, rftFloat, rftFloat, rftFloat, rftDate, rftTime, rftDateTime, // ftBoolean, ftFloat, ftCurrency, ftBCD, ftDate, ftTime, ftDateTime,
|
||||||
rftBlob, rftBlob, rftInteger, rftBlob, rftString, rftUnknown, rftString, // ftBytes, ftVarBytes, ftAutoInc, ftBlob, ftMemo, ftGraphic, ftFmtMemo,
|
rftBlob, rftBlob, rftInteger, rftBlob, rftString, rftUnknown, rftString, // ftBytes, ftVarBytes, ftAutoInc, ftBlob, ftMemo, ftGraphic, ftFmtMemo,
|
||||||
rftUnknown, rftUnknown, rftUnknown, rftUnknown, rftString, // ftParadoxOle, ftDBaseOle, ftTypedBinary, ftCursor, ftFixedChar,
|
rftUnknown, rftUnknown, rftUnknown, rftUnknown, rftString, // ftParadoxOle, ftDBaseOle, ftTypedBinary, ftCursor, ftFixedChar,
|
||||||
rftString, rftLargeInt, rftUnknown, rftUnknown, rftUnknown, // ftWideString, ftLargeint, ftADT, ftArray, ftReference,
|
rftString, rftLargeInt, rftUnknown, rftUnknown, rftUnknown, // ftWideString, ftLargeint, ftADT, ftArray, ftReference,
|
||||||
rftUnknown, rftBlob, rftBlob, rftUnknown, rftUnknown, // ftDataSet, ftOraBlob, ftOraClob, ftVariant, ftInterface,
|
rftUnknown, rftBlob, rftBlob, rftUnknown, rftUnknown, // ftDataSet, ftOraBlob, ftOraClob, ftVariant, ftInterface,
|
||||||
rftUnknown, rftString, rftDateTime, rftFloat, rftString, rftString /// ftIDispatch, ftGuid, ftTimeStamp, ftFMTBcd, ftFixedWideChar, ftWideMemo
|
rftUnknown, rftString, rftDateTime, rftFloat, rftString, rftString, // ftIDispatch, ftGuid, ftTimeStamp, ftFMTBcd, ftFixedWideChar, ftWideMemo
|
||||||
|
rftDateTime, rftDateTime, rftInteger, rftInteger, rftInteger, rftFloat // ftOraTimeStamp, ftOraInterval, ftLongWord, ftShortint, ftByte, ftExtended
|
||||||
);
|
);
|
||||||
|
|
||||||
begin
|
begin
|
||||||
|
Loading…
Reference in New Issue
Block a user